How to fill out loan fact sheet

How to fill out loan fact sheet
01
To fill out a loan fact sheet, follow these steps:
02
Begin by gathering all the necessary information such as the loan amount, interest rate, and term.
03
Fill in the loan amount in the designated field. This represents the total amount you plan to borrow.
04
Enter the interest rate for the loan. This can be a fixed rate or a variable rate, depending on the terms of the loan.
05
Specify the loan term, which refers to the duration of the loan repayment period. Common terms include 1 year, 5 years, or 10 years.
06
Include any additional fees or charges associated with the loan, if applicable.
07
Provide details about any collateral or security that may be required for the loan.
08
Finally, review the filled-out loan fact sheet for accuracy and completeness before submitting it.
Who needs loan fact sheet?
01
Loan fact sheets are typically needed by borrowers who are applying for loans. These borrowers may be individuals, businesses, or financial institutions seeking funding for various purposes such as buying a house, starting a business, or financing an investment. Loan fact sheets serve as a crucial document for lenders to assess the borrower's creditworthiness and determine the terms and conditions of the loan.

What is loan fact sheet?
A loan fact sheet is a document that provides detailed information about a loan, including terms, interest rates, fees, and repayment schedule.
Who is required to file loan fact sheet?
Lenders or financial institutions are typically required to file a loan fact sheet.
How to fill out loan fact sheet?
To fill out a loan fact sheet, you will need to provide all necessary information about the loan, such as loan amount, interest rate, repayment terms, and any additional fees.
What is the purpose of loan fact sheet?
The purpose of a loan fact sheet is to provide transparency and ensure that borrowers have all the necessary information about a loan before making a decision to borrow.
What information must be reported on loan fact sheet?
Information such as loan amount, interest rate, repayment schedule, fees, and any other relevant terms and conditions must be reported on a loan fact sheet.
